Pretrial motions

Pretrial motions – in the Civil Trials, the pre-trial motions usually seek the goal to secure the interests of the claimant in relation to the prospective claim. For example in some jurisdictions this could be the specific request made by the claimant towards the judge, to allow burdening the defendant’s assets to secure the outcome of the prospective claim is pre-trial action. Especially in cases where the main claim may not be submitted yet by the plaintiff. Somewhere called also “pretrial actions”
